How they compare

Pakistan currently reports 2,027 US dollar per square kilometre against 1,492 US dollar per square kilometre in Congo, Democratic Republic of the, a difference of 535 US dollar per square kilometre.

That makes Pakistan's figure about 1.4 times Congo, Democratic Republic of the's.

Across all 8 years both countries report, Pakistan has been ahead every year.

Congo, Democratic Republic of the ranks 140th and Pakistan ranks 139th of 165 countries.

Pakistan has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
